About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Build AI agents that solve real engineering problems across the networking stack — and ship them to daily use.
- Design and build the platforms that make those agents reliable: typed tool surfaces, cloud services, and the systems behind them.
- Work broadly across networking architecture teams to identify high-impact AI use cases and turn them into working solutions.
- Drive rapid and responsible AI adoption across the organization: establish best practices, guardrails, and evaluation methods so teams embrace agentic workflows with confidence.
- Build evaluation pipelines that measure and improve AI-agent behavior on real production workloads.
Requirements
What you’ll need- BSc in Computer Science or a related field,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years of relevant practical experience in software development, including working on a large-scale software product.
- Advanced, demonstrable use of AI and agentic workflows in your daily engineering work well beyond standard coding assistant usage.
- A fast learner, comfortable moving across codebases, domains, and teams.
- A drive for end-to-end ownership and strong communication skills.
